Possible Causes of Mold Growth in Air Ducts

Mold in your air ducts often results from excess moisture and poor ventilation within your home or building. When moisture gets trapped in ductwork due to leaks, condensation, or high humidity levels, it creates an ideal environment for mold spores to thrive. If your HVAC system isn’t functioning properly or if air filters aren’t replaced regularly, the likelihood of mold growth increases significantly.

Additionally, water damage from leaks or flooding nearby can introduce excess moisture into your duct system. Over time, this moisture opportunity promotes mold colonies to develop, which can then circulate throughout your indoor space whenever your system is operational. Recognizing these causes early can help prevent extensive mold contamination and protect your indoor air quality.

How We Can Fix Air Duct Mold Issues

Our team begins every mold removal project by thoroughly inspecting your air duct system. We identify all the areas affected by mold and assess the source of moisture to prevent future growth. Using specialized equipment, we carefully remove moldy debris and contaminated insulation to eliminate the existing mold colonies.

We then use professional-grade cleaning solutions designed specifically to eradicate mold spores from duct surfaces without damaging your HVAC system. Once the cleaning is complete, we implement advanced drying techniques to eliminate residual moisture, reducing the risk of mold returning. Finally, we sanitize your air ducts to ensure your indoor air remains healthy and mold-free.

Our experts also recommend preventative measures, such as improving your home’s ventilation and sealing leaks, to keep your duct system dry and mold-resistant. Frequently Asked Questions

How do I know if my air ducts have mold?

Signs include musty odors, visible mold spots, and increased allergy or respiratory issues indoors. A professional inspection can confirm mold presence and extent.

Is mold in air ducts dangerous?

Yes, mold spores can negatively impact your indoor air quality and health, especially for those with allergies or respiratory conditions. Professional removal is essential for safety.

How long does mold removal take?

Most projects are completed within one to two days, depending on the extent of contamination. Our team works efficiently to minimize your downtime.

Can I clean mold from my air ducts myself?

While minor cleaning might be tempting, mold removal requires specialized equipment and expertise to ensure all spores are eradicated safely. It’s best to seek professional assistance.

What can I do to prevent mold in my air ducts?

Maintaining proper humidity levels, fixing leaks promptly, regularly changing filters, and scheduling routine duct cleaning can help prevent mold growth and ensure a healthier indoor environment.
